Hello everyone,


it seems that we have a problem with our CRM VSS Writer.

In the services i can see, that the "MS Dynamics CRM VSS Writer" Service is stopped.

When i want to start that service, it loads at first, but then brakes up with the error code 1053.

I already restartet the server.

please help.

kind regards,

b.maassen

    Hi  Can you make sure in SQL Server The SQL Server VSS Writer service is Started?

    The VSS Writer Service provides added functionality for backing up and restoring Microsoft Dynamics CRM databases through the VSS framework to centrally manage the backup and restore operations on a variety of applications.
